From 8efe8c2840f44ca0642490eedbb889f1f39a37fd Mon Sep 17 00:00:00 2001 From: trivernis Date: Sun, 7 Jul 2024 17:49:18 +0200 Subject: [PATCH] Add random stuff --- package-lock.json | 8 ++- package.json | 3 +- .../atoms/ContainerDualColumn.svelte | 14 ++++-- src/components/atoms/ZigZag.svelte | 50 +++++++++++++++++++ src/components/molecules/Filler.svelte | 17 +++++++ src/components/organisms/Introduction.svelte | 2 +- src/lib/index.ts | 4 ++ src/routes/+page.svelte | 15 ++++-- 8 files changed, 102 insertions(+), 11 deletions(-) create mode 100644 src/components/atoms/ZigZag.svelte create mode 100644 src/components/molecules/Filler.svelte diff --git a/package-lock.json b/package-lock.json index a820bf5..140c1a9 100644 --- a/package-lock.json +++ b/package-lock.json @@ -11,7 +11,8 @@ "moment": "^2.30.1", "qs": "^6.12.2", "sanitize.css": "^13.0.0", - "svelte-markdown": "^0.4.1" + "svelte-markdown": "^0.4.1", + "svg-round-corners": "^0.4.3" }, "devDependencies": { "@sveltejs/adapter-auto": "^3.0.0", @@ -2525,6 +2526,11 @@ } } }, + "node_modules/svg-round-corners": { + "version": "0.4.3", + "resolved": "https://registry.npmjs.org/svg-round-corners/-/svg-round-corners-0.4.3.tgz", + "integrity": "sha512-9zxcdLa9Bh2Bddxa760wSzspWLJ1nTRMKIsVH6MjNm8QssbZGbmY0pOnjwrp/cST+mfod2l3lpbuKFe+c3wHjw==" + }, "node_modules/tiny-glob": { "version": "0.2.9", "resolved": "https://registry.npmjs.org/tiny-glob/-/tiny-glob-0.2.9.tgz", diff --git a/package.json b/package.json index ef881d4..845c849 100644 --- a/package.json +++ b/package.json @@ -28,6 +28,7 @@ "moment": "^2.30.1", "qs": "^6.12.2", "sanitize.css": "^13.0.0", - "svelte-markdown": "^0.4.1" + "svelte-markdown": "^0.4.1", + "svg-round-corners": "^0.4.3" } } diff --git a/src/components/atoms/ContainerDualColumn.svelte b/src/components/atoms/ContainerDualColumn.svelte index 01e8369..9264d2b 100644 --- a/src/components/atoms/ContainerDualColumn.svelte +++ b/src/components/atoms/ContainerDualColumn.svelte @@ -1,11 +1,11 @@
@@ -31,7 +31,8 @@ } .column-left { - width: var(--column-left-width); + height: 100%; + flex: var(--column-left-flex); @include portrait { width: 100%; @@ -40,6 +41,8 @@ .column-spacer { width: 2em; + display: flex; + height: 2em; @include portrait { display: none; @@ -47,7 +50,8 @@ } .column-right { - width: var(--column-right-width); + height: 100%; + flex: var(--column-right-flex); @include portrait { width: 100%; diff --git a/src/components/atoms/ZigZag.svelte b/src/components/atoms/ZigZag.svelte new file mode 100644 index 0000000..27af4ac --- /dev/null +++ b/src/components/atoms/ZigZag.svelte @@ -0,0 +1,50 @@ + + +
+ + + +
+ + diff --git a/src/components/molecules/Filler.svelte b/src/components/molecules/Filler.svelte new file mode 100644 index 0000000..38539e2 --- /dev/null +++ b/src/components/molecules/Filler.svelte @@ -0,0 +1,17 @@ + + +
+ +
+ + diff --git a/src/components/organisms/Introduction.svelte b/src/components/organisms/Introduction.svelte index 07fcdcb..099c8f8 100644 --- a/src/components/organisms/Introduction.svelte +++ b/src/components/organisms/Introduction.svelte @@ -7,7 +7,7 @@ - +

Welcome to my website

- +
+
- +